是指将一个包含多个对象的json字符串转换为对应的对象集合的过程。在云计算领域中,反序列化json字符串常用于处理从云端返回的数据,以便在应用程序中进行进一步的处理和展示。
在前端开发中,可以使用JavaScript的JSON.parse()方法将json字符串转换为JavaScript对象。在后端开发中,可以使用各种编程语言提供的json反序列化库或框架来实现反序列化操作。
反序列化json字符串中的多个对象的步骤如下:
- 解析json字符串:使用相应的编程语言提供的json解析器或库,将json字符串解析为对应的数据结构。
- 遍历解析结果:根据解析后的数据结构,遍历其中的对象集合。
- 创建对象集合:根据遍历的结果,创建对应的对象集合,并将解析后的数据填充到对象中。
- 返回对象集合:将创建好的对象集合返回给调用方,以便进行后续的处理和展示。
反序列化json字符串中的多个对象的优势在于可以方便地将云端返回的数据转换为应用程序中的对象集合,便于后续的数据处理和展示。同时,使用json作为数据交换格式具有简洁、易读、易解析的特点,能够提高数据传输的效率和可靠性。
反序列化json字符串中的多个对象的应用场景广泛,包括但不限于以下几个方面:
- Web应用程序:在Web应用程序中,常常需要从云端获取数据并展示给用户。通过反序列化json字符串中的多个对象,可以将云端返回的数据转换为前端所需的对象集合,便于进行数据展示和交互。
- 移动应用程序:在移动应用程序中,常常需要从云端获取数据并进行本地展示和处理。通过反序列化json字符串中的多个对象,可以将云端返回的数据转换为移动应用程序中的对象集合,方便进行后续的数据处理和展示。
- 数据分析和挖掘:在数据分析和挖掘领域,常常需要对大量的数据进行处理和分析。通过反序列化json字符串中的多个对象,可以将云端返回的数据转换为可供分析和挖掘的对象集合,方便进行数据分析和挖掘的工作。
腾讯云提供了多个与json反序列化相关的产品和服务,包括:
- 云函数(Serverless):腾讯云云函数是一种无服务器计算服务,可以根据实际需求自动弹性地运行代码。通过云函数,可以方便地处理和解析json字符串中的多个对象。
- 云数据库(CDB):腾讯云云数据库是一种高性能、可扩展的云端数据库服务,支持多种数据库引擎。通过云数据库,可以存储和管理反序列化后的对象集合。
- 云存储(COS):腾讯云云存储是一种安全、稳定、低成本的云端存储服务,支持多种数据存储和访问方式。通过云存储,可以方便地存储和管理反序列化后的对象集合。
以上是腾讯云相关产品的简要介绍,更详细的产品信息和介绍可以参考腾讯云官方网站:https://cloud.tencent.com/